Szoftveres RAID1

A tesztgépemben 2db 73GB-os SATA HDD van. A rendszert feltelepítettem a /dev/sda-ra a /dev/sdb-n pedig létrehoztam egy ext3 fájlrendszert. A telepítést az Ubuntu 6.10 server változatán végeztem, de valószínűleg az újabb kiadásoknál is működik a módszer.
Első lépés egy tool telepítése. Rövid keresgélés után találtam is egyet:

sudo apt-cache search raid

[…]
mdadm – tool to administer Linux MD device arrays (software RAID)

sudo apt-get install mdadm

Ha ezt megvan a következő parancsot lehet találni a man mdadm manual oldalon:

sudo mdadm --create /dev/md0 --level=1 --raid-devices=2 /dev/sda /dev/sdb
 

Láthatjuk a parancsból a –create /dev/md0 parancsal hozzuk létre a tömböt, utána megadjuk, hogy két eszközből fog állni, ami a /dev/sda és sdb.
Honnan jött nekem az sda és sdb?

sudo fdisk -l

Ez megmutatja milyen partíciók vannak a szerverünkben.
Első hiba: kiadtam a fenti parancsot. Hibát írt ki, hogy nem létezik a /dev/md0. Hogyan kell létrehozni?

mdrun

Ennyi (paraméterezések nélkül), és máris meg lehet nézni a következő parancs kimenetét:

ls -l /dev/md*

Ezt követően fel kell mountolni az sdb1 partíciót.

sudo mkdir /media/sdb1
sudo mount /dev/sdb1 /mount/sdb1

Most már ki lehet adni a parancsot.

sudo mdadm --create /dev/md0 --level=1 --raid-devices=2 /dev/sda /dev/sdb

Ekkor szinkronizálja a meghajtókat, ami esetemben nagyjából 25 percig tartott.
Az eredmény ellenőrizhetjük így:

cat /proc/mdstat

Personalities : [raid1]
md0 : active raid1 sda[0] sdb[1]
78156224 blocks [2/2] [UU]

RAID1, neve md0, mely sda és sdb eszközből áll.

fdisk -l /dev/md0

Disk /dev/md0: 80.0 GB, 80031973376 bytes
255 heads, 63 sectors/track, 9729 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ytesDevice Boot Start End Blocks Id System
/dev/md0p1 1 1216 9767488+ 83 Linux
/dev/md0p2 1217 9730 68388705 5 Extended
/dev/md0p5 1217 1338 979933+ 82 Linux swap / Solaris
/dev/md0p6 1339 9730 67408708+ 83 Linux

Szerző: Budacsik
Creative Commons LicenseEz a Mű a Creative Commons Nevezd meg!-Így add tovább! 2.5 Magyarország Licenc feltételeinek megfelelően szabadon felhasználható.

1 thought on “Szoftveres RAID1

Vélemény, hozzászólás?

Az e-mail cím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ük

Ez az oldal az Akismet szolgáltatást használja a spam csökkentésére. Ismerje meg a hozzászólás adatainak feldolgozását .